Output 24228465d8583fa153d1d03460df63ebdb1242a371bc8da84ee14e0c59b68f10:0

value
139170000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 407853d396879ac7ebc5a1726aafc0f487546440 OP_EQUALVERIFY OP_CHECKSIG
address
16stPmwHHhzRsPzRYsgosK558FnPLAkaSJ
transaction
24228465d8583fa153d1d03460df63ebdb1242a371bc8da84ee14e0c59b68f10
confirmations
604392
spent
true